The lifespan of your iPhone is a critical factor when considering an upgrade or purchasing a used device. Apple consistently provides software support for its products, but understanding the duration of that support is key to making an informed decision. Generally, you can anticipate seven to eight years of crucial security updates, with hardware repairs often available for five to seven years after a model is discontinued.

As of late 2025, a significant shift has occurred. The iPhone XS and XR, once popular choices, will no longer be compatible with the latest operating system, iOS 26. This doesn’t immediately render them useless, however. Apple frequently releases vital security patches for older iOS versions, extending their usability even after official updates cease.

Currently, Apple continues to provide security updates for iPhones running iOS 18, and may even extend support to iOS 17. However, reliance on older versions carries inherent risks, as these devices become increasingly vulnerable to newly discovered security flaws. For optimal protection, replacing an iPhone unable to run iOS 18 is strongly recommended.

Every version of iOS supported

The history of iOS support reveals a growing trend. The original iPhone, launched in 2007, received updates for roughly three years. With each generation, Apple has extended this commitment. The iPhone 4s, for example, benefited from updates for eight years, even receiving a GPS-related fix in 2019 long after its prime.

Remarkably, even the 2014 iPhone 6s continues to receive security updates through iOS 15, demonstrating over a decade of support from Apple. This longevity is a testament to the company’s dedication to user security, but it doesn’t mean older devices are immune to obsolescence.

Apple categorizes its products as “Vintage” or “Obsolete.” Vintage products are no longer actively sold by Apple but may still receive limited servicing with available parts. Obsolete products have been discontinued for over seven years, and Apple no longer provides hardware repairs.

Currently, the iPhone 6s represents the oldest device still receiving security updates, though it’s already classified as obsolete. As iOS 25 becomes established, support for iOS 16 and 15 is expected to diminish, leaving the iPhone 8 and iPhone X without critical security patches.

To help you navigate this landscape, consider avoiding the following models, as they are nearing or have reached the end of their supported lifespan: iPhone 11/11 Pro, iPhone XR, iPhone XS/XS Max, iPhone X, iPhone 8/8 Plus, iPhone 7/7 Plus, iPhone SE (2016), iPhone 6s/6s Plus, iPhone 6/6 Plus, iPhone 5s, iPhone 5c, iPhone 5, iPhone 4s, iPhone 4, iPhone 3GS, iPhone 3G, and the original iPhone.

Predicting the exact end-of-life for each iPhone is challenging, but Apple generally supports devices for five to seven years after they are no longer sold. This means the iPhone XS could see support through 2026, while the iPhone 15 might remain supported until around 2035. The introduction of Apple Intelligence and its hardware requirements may accelerate the obsolescence of older models.
